はじめに
サーバー障害のリスクを理解し、冗長構成の重要性を探る サーバー障害は、企業にとって避けられないリスクの一つです。特に、データの損失やサービスの停止は、業務運営に深刻な影響を及ぼす可能性があります。そのため、冗長構成の導入は非常に重要です。冗長構成とは、システムの信頼性を高めるために、同じ機能を持つ複数のコンポーネントを設置することを指します。これにより、万が一一つのコンポーネントが故障しても、他のコンポーネントがその役割を引き継ぎ、システム全体が機能し続けることが可能になります。 本プログラムでは、サーバー障害の原因やその影響を明確に理解し、冗長構成の具体的な実践方法を学ぶことを目指します。特に、IT部門の管理者や企業経営陣にとって、これらの知識は不可欠です。冗長構成を効果的に実装することで、企業はビジネスの継続性を確保し、顧客の信頼を維持することができます。次の章では、サーバー障害の具体的な原因とその影響について詳しく探っていきます。
冗長構成の基礎知識とその必要性
冗長構成は、システムの信頼性を高めるための重要な手法です。具体的には、ハードウェアやソフトウェアの冗長性を持たせることで、単一障害点を排除し、システム全体の可用性を向上させます。例えば、サーバーの冗長構成では、複数のサーバーを用意し、主サーバーが故障した際にはバックアップサーバーが自動的に稼働する仕組みを構築します。このような構成により、サービスの停止を防ぎ、ユーザーへの影響を最小限に抑えることが可能です。 冗長構成の必要性は、特にビジネス環境において顕著です。顧客の期待に応えるためには、常に安定したサービスを提供することが求められます。また、データ損失のリスクを軽減するためにも、冗長構成は不可欠です。万が一の障害時にも、迅速に復旧できる体制を整えることで、企業の信頼性を高めることができます。 さらに、冗長構成はコスト面でも長期的なメリットをもたらします。初期投資は必要ですが、障害による損失やダウンタイムを考慮すると、結果的には企業の資産を守ることにつながります。したがって、冗長構成は単なる技術的な選択肢ではなく、企業戦略の一部として捉えるべきです。次の章では、具体的な冗長構成の事例や実装方法について詳しく解説します。
冗長構成の設計原則と実装方法
冗長構成の設計は、システムの信頼性を高めるための基盤となります。まず、冗長性を持たせるコンポーネントを特定することが重要です。これには、サーバー、ストレージ、ネットワーク機器などが含まれます。それぞれのコンポーネントには、単一障害点(Single Point of Failure, SPOF)を排除するための冗長性を設計する必要があります。例えば、サーバーの冗長化には、アクティブ-アクティブ構成やアクティブ-スタンバイ構成があり、前者は複数のサーバーが同時に稼働し、負荷を分散するのに対し、後者は一つのサーバーが故障した場合にのみバックアップが稼働します。 次に、冗長構成を実装する際には、適切な監視システムの導入が不可欠です。これにより、各コンポーネントの稼働状況をリアルタイムで把握し、障害が発生した際に迅速な対応が可能になります。さらに、定期的なテストを行い、冗長構成が正しく機能していることを確認することも重要です。テストには、障害発生時の復旧手順をシミュレーションすることが含まれ、これにより実際の障害時における対応力を向上させることができます。 また、冗長構成を導入する際には、コストとリスクのバランスを考慮することが重要です。初期投資はかかりますが、長期的にはダウンタイムの削減やデータ損失の防止につながります。これにより、企業は顧客の信頼を維持し、競争力を高めることができます。次の章では、具体的な冗長構成の事例を紹介し、その効果を詳しく探っていきます。
実際の事例から学ぶ冗長構成の成功と失敗
冗長構成の実践には成功例と失敗例が存在し、それぞれから多くの教訓を得ることができます。成功事例の一つとして、ある大手クラウドサービスプロバイダーのケースを挙げます。この企業は、アクティブ-アクティブ構成を採用し、複数のデータセンターで同時にサービスを提供する体制を構築しました。この結果、サーバーの一部に障害が発生した際も、他のデータセンターが自動的に負荷を引き受け、顧客への影響を最小限に抑えることができました。定期的なテストと監視システムが整備されていたため、障害発生時の迅速な対応も実現しました。 一方で、失敗事例も存在します。中小企業が冗長構成を導入する際、コスト削減を優先した結果、十分な冗長性を確保できなかったケースです。この企業は、サーバーのバックアップを一台だけに頼り、定期的なメンテナンスも怠っていました。その結果、主サーバーに障害が発生した際、バックアップサーバーも同時に故障し、データが失われる事態に至りました。この失敗から得られる教訓は、冗長構成の設計においてコストだけでなく、信頼性を重視することの重要性です。 これらの事例から、冗長構成の設計と実装においては、信頼性や可用性を確保するための投資が不可欠であることが明らかです。次の章では、具体的な冗長構成を実現するための手法とその効果について詳しく解説します。
冗長構成の運用管理と監視のベストプラクティス
冗長構成の運用管理と監視は、システムの信頼性を維持するために欠かせない要素です。まず、運用管理においては、定期的なメンテナンスとアップデートを行うことが重要です。これにより、ハードウェアやソフトウェアの劣化を防ぎ、常に最適なパフォーマンスを確保できます。また、冗長構成を維持するためには、各コンポーネントの状態を常に把握し、必要に応じて適切な対応を行うことが求められます。 監視システムの導入も不可欠です。リアルタイムでの監視は、障害の兆候を早期に発見し、迅速な対応を可能にします。例えば、負荷状況や稼働時間を監視することで、異常が発生する前に予防策を講じることができます。さらに、監視データの分析を通じて、システムのパフォーマンスを向上させるための改善点を見つけ出すことも重要です。 また、定期的なテストを実施し、冗長構成が期待通りに機能するか確認することも大切です。障害発生時の復旧手順をシミュレーションし、実際の状況に備えることで、万が一の事態にも冷静に対応できる体制を整えます。このように、運用管理と監視を適切に行うことで、冗長構成の効果を最大限に引き出し、企業の信頼性を高めることが可能になります。次の章では、冗長構成における具体的な運用管理の手法とその効果について探っていきます。
人材育成における冗長構成の教育プログラムの構築
人材育成において、冗長構成の理解と実践は非常に重要です。企業が持続的に成長し、競争力を維持するためには、IT部門のスタッフが冗長構成の原則をしっかりと理解し、実際の業務に応用できる能力を身につける必要があります。そのためには、教育プログラムの構築が欠かせません。 まず、プログラムの内容には、冗長構成の基本概念や設計方法、実装事例などを含めるべきです。具体的なケーススタディを通じて、受講者が実際のシナリオでの判断力を養うことができるようにします。また、実践的な演習を取り入れることで、学んだ知識を即座に適用できるスキルを身につけることが可能です。 さらに、定期的な評価を行い、受講者の理解度を確認することも重要です。これにより、プログラムの効果を測定し、必要に応じて内容を見直すことができます。また、最新の技術動向や業界のベストプラクティスに基づいた情報を常に提供することで、受講者が常に最前線の知識を持つことができるように努めるべきです。 このように、冗長構成に関する教育プログラムを構築することで、企業全体のITインフラの信頼性を向上させ、結果的にビジネスの継続性を確保することができます。次の章では、プログラムの実施における具体的な手法とその効果について詳しく解説します。
冗長構成の習得がもたらす未来のサーバー運用
冗長構成の習得は、企業のサーバー運用において非常に重要な要素です。これにより、システムの信頼性が向上し、業務の継続性が確保されます。特に、IT部門の管理者や経営陣が冗長構成の原則を理解し、実践することは、顧客の信頼を維持し、競争力を高めるために不可欠です。 冗長構成の導入は、単なる技術的な選択肢ではなく、企業戦略の一部として捉えるべきです。具体的な設計や実装、運用管理の方法を学ぶことで、企業は障害発生時のリスクを軽減し、迅速な復旧を実現できます。また、定期的な教育プログラムを通じて、スタッフのスキルを向上させることが、長期的な成功につながります。 今後のサーバー運用において、冗長構成の理解と実践は、企業の成長と持続可能性を支える重要な基盤となります。これにより、企業は変化するビジネス環境に柔軟に対応し、安定したサービスを提供し続けることができるでしょう。
今すぐ冗長構成のスキルを身につけよう!
冗長構成のスキルを身につけることは、企業のITインフラを強化し、業務の継続性を確保するために不可欠です。今こそ、専門的な教育プログラムを受講し、実践的な知識を習得する絶好の機会です。プログラムでは、冗長構成の基本的な概念から、具体的な設計・実装方法、運用管理に至るまで、幅広い内容を網羅しています。受講者は、実際の事例を通じて判断力を養い、即戦力となるスキルを身につけることができます。 また、定期的な評価や最新の技術動向に基づく情報提供を通じて、常に最前線の知識を持ち続けることも可能です。冗長構成の理解を深めることで、企業全体のITインフラの信頼性を向上させ、顧客の信頼を維持することができます。ぜひ、この機会を逃さず、冗長構成のスキルを磨いて、企業の成長に寄与していきましょう。
冗長構成導入時の落とし穴とその対策
冗長構成を導入する際には、いくつかの落とし穴が存在します。まず、過剰な冗長化を行うことによるコストの増大です。冗長構成は信頼性を高める手段ですが、必要以上に複雑な構成を採用すると、管理や運用の負担が増し、逆にリスクを高めることになります。したがって、冗長性を持たせるコンポーネントは、ビジネスニーズに基づいて適切に選定することが重要です。 次に、監視システムの不備も問題です。冗長構成の効果を最大限に引き出すためには、各コンポーネントの状態をリアルタイムで把握し、異常が発生した際には迅速に対応する必要があります。監視システムが不十分であると、障害の兆候を見逃し、システム全体に影響を及ぼす可能性があります。 さらに、定期的なテストを怠ることも注意が必要です。冗長構成が正しく機能しているかを確認するためには、障害発生時の復旧手順をシミュレーションすることが不可欠です。テストを行わないと、実際の障害時において適切な対応ができない事態に陥る恐れがあります。 これらの注意点を踏まえ、冗長構成の導入には計画的なアプローチが求められます。コストとリスクのバランスを考え、適切な監視や定期的なテストを行うことで、企業のシステム信頼性を高めることができます。
補足情報
※株式会社情報工学研究所は(以下、当社)は、細心の注意を払って当社ウェブサイトに情報を掲載しておりますが、この情報の正確性および完全性を保証するものではありません。当社は予告なしに、当社ウェブサイトに掲載されている情報を変更することがあります。当社およびその関連会社は、お客さまが当社ウェブサイトに含まれる情報もしくは内容をご利用されたことで直接・間接的に生じた損失に関し一切責任を負うものではありません。
